United Cerebral Palsy of Georgia is seeking a reliable Class 2 Driver for an immediate start in Llandudno. This role involves driving a Class 2 vehicle along local routes, working as part of a dedicated team, and maintaining safety and efficiency in daily operations.

Ideal candidates will hold a valid Class 2 driving licence, CPC qualification, and have a clean driving record. The position offers consistent weekday work with potential for permanent employment.
